Judicial Independence and Political Tensions in Israel
This chapter delves into the intricate dynamics of Israel's political arena, centering on the tension between governmental authority and judicial independence. It examines the challenges presented by right-wing factions against the judiciary, highlighting the consequences of a lack of formal checks and balances.
